    Quote Originally Posted by CTom View Post
    Now this has me thinking. Great idea. On the nails, are you using a galvanized nail or a coated sinker with the varnish removed before dipping?Also, did you smooth out the end of the nail at all? Round it off a bit instead of leaving the sharp point?
    we are using regular steel nails I put a little bit of vegetable oil on a rag and wipe the nails I take each nail and get them and sent them into my holder made out of a piece of wood real simple you could actually make a little bored if you have a dish big enough for your plastic you can make a lot of these in a big hurry I will enclose a picture here to show you what I have done.
